Abook that weighs 0.35 kilograms is kept on a shelf that’s 2.0 meters above the ground. a picture frame that weighs 0.5 kilograms will have the same gravitational potential energy as the book when it’s raised to a height of meters. (use pe = m × g × h, where g = 9.8 n/kg. )

A picture frame will have the same gravitational potential energy as the book when it’s raised to a height of 1.4 m.
Explanation:
Given that,
Weight of book = 0.35 kg
Height of shelf = 2.0 m
Weight of frame = 0.5 kg
Using formula of gravitational potential energy
Gravitational potential energy = mgh
Where, m = mass
g = acceleration due to gravity
h = height
A picture frame that weighs 0.5 kilograms will have the same gravitational potential energy as the book when it’s raised to a height.
Therefore,
Gravitational potential energy of book = gravitational potential energy of frame
mgh=m'gh'
We substitute the value into equation (I)
Hence, A picture frame will have the same gravitational potential energy as the book when it’s raised to a height of 1.4 m.
